统信uos安装mysql9
建立mysql用户和用户组
sudo groupadd mysql
sudo useradd -r -g mysql -s /bin/false mysql
下载mysql安装包
wget https://cdn.mysql.com//downloads/mysql-9.1/mysql-9.1.0-linux-glibc2.28-x86_64.tar.xz
解压缩mysql安装包
sudo tar -xvf mysql-9.1.0-linux-glibc2.28-x86_64.tar.xz
移动安装包到指定目录
sudo mv mysql-9.1.0-linux-glibc2.28-x86_64 /usr/local/mysql
创建链接符号目录
sudo mkdir /usr/local/mysql/mysql-files
修改目录所属
sudo chown -r mysql:mysql /usr/local/mysql
链接符号目录授权
sudo chmod 750 /usr/local/mysql/mysql-files
配置环境变量
临时环境变量
export path=$path:/usr/local/mysql/bin
永久环境变量
sudo vim /etc/profile
末尾追加以下内容
export path=$path:/usr/local/mysql/bin
初始化数据库
sudo /usr/local/mysql/bin/mysqld --initialize --user=mysql
注意:mysql初始密码会打印在控制台上
例如:[note] [my-010454] [server] a temporary password is generated for root@localhost: .mt/utw%<5&=
启动mysql
sudo /usr/local/mysql/bin/mysqld_safe --user=mysql &
修改mysql root用户密码和授权可访问主机
打开新的控制台执行以下命令
sudo /usr/local/mysql/bin/mysql -uroot -p
根据提示输入之前打印在控制台上的mysql初始密码
注意:第一次输入可能是操作系统用户密码
修改 root 用户密码为 lihaozhe
alter user 'root'@'localhost' identified by 'lihaozhe'; flush privileges;
授权任意主机皆可访问
update mysql.user set host = '%' where user = 'root'; flush privileges;
退出mysql
exit;
设置mysql服务
在新的控制台执行以下命令
sudo c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ysql.server
控制 mysql 可以使用 以下命令
sudo systemctl start mysql sudo systemctl stop mysql sudo systemctl restart mysql sudo systemctl reloead mysql
或者
sudo service mysql.server start sudo service mysql.server stop sudo service mysql.server restart sudo service mysql.server reloead
测试
重启操作系统
手动开启mysql服务
sudo systemctl start mysql
或者
sudo service mysql.server start
登录mysql
使用自定义密码登录
mysql -uroot -p
到此这篇关于统信uos 安装二级制版mysql9的图文步骤的文章就介绍到这了,更多相关统信uos安装二级制版mysql9内容请搜索代码网以前的文章或继续浏览下面的相关文章希望大家以后多多支持代码网!
发表评论